I have a weird problem with 3 switchs A5500 (JG311A) after an upgrade.

I did the next steps :

- tftp ;
- bootrom update file A5500HI-CMW520-R5501P25.bin slot  ;
- copy a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p25.bin slot2#flash:/ ;
- copy a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p25.bin slot3#flash:/ ;
- boot-loader file A5500hi-cmw520-r5501p25.bin slot all main ;
- reboot slot 3 (or reboot slot 2 or reboot slot 1, same problem).

then agfter reboot, I saw this message : "System is busy in recovering configuration, please wait a moment"
then I type "display boot-loader", I get these :

<sw-mop-irf>display boot-loader
 Slot 2
The current boot app is:  fl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p21.bin
The main boot app is:     fl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p25.bin
The backup boot app is:   flash:/
 Slot 1
The current boot app is:  fl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p21.bin
The main boot app is:     fl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p25.bin
The backup boot app is:   fl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5206.bin
 Slot 3
The current boot app is:  fl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p21.bin
The main boot app is:     fl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p25.bin
The backup boot app is:   flash:/

 

And after the error message :

<sw-mop-irf>display boot-loader
 Slot 2
The current boot app is:  fl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p21.bin
The main boot app is:     fl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p21.bin
The backup boot app is:   flash:/
 Slot 1
The current boot app is:  fl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p21.bin
The main boot app is:     fl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p21.bin
The backup boot app is:   fl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5206.bin
 Slot 3
The current boot app is:  fl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p21.bin
The main boot app is:     flash:/a5500hi-cmw520-r5501p21.bin
The backup boot app is:   flash:/

 

Someone can help me ? :)
